Shackleton, Sir Ernest Henry
|
| sex:
| male
|
| lived:
| (1874–1922)
|
| biography:
| Explorer, born in Kilkea, Co Kildare, E Ireland. He was a junior officer in Scott's National Antarctic Expedition (1901–3), and nearly reached the South Pole in his own expedition of 1909. In 1915 his ship Endurance was crushed in the ice, and he and five others made a perilous journey of 1300 km/800 mi to bring relief for the crew. Knighted in 1909, he died at South Georgia during a fourth expedition. |
